MATH 4375 - Introduction to Abstract Algebra (3 Cr.)

Mathematics & Statistics (10345) DCSE - Swenson College of Science and Engineering

Course description

This course is intended for mathematics or statistics majors. The focus of the course is to introduce students to abstract algebra. Topics include groups, permutation, quotient groups, homomorphisms, and rings.

pre-req: Math 3355 with a grade of C- or better is required and a grade of B- or better is recommended; no grad credit
